Selecting inspiration photos for furniture and decor
The best place to start shopping is with a picture of a room or outdoor space that you like. There are a few ways to grab a picture:
-
Phone or tablet – You can take your own picture of a place you visit in real life or simply screenshot a magazine or book. Depending on how you have your device configured, you should be able to email the picture to yourself or use a cord to transfer the picture to your computer.
-
Mac computer – Hold down Command – Shift – Four and use your cursor to select the picture you want to use for your search.
-
Windows computer – There are a couple screenshot tools that come with Windows computers. If you open your Start menu and search for the word “snip” you should see a screenshot tool such as Snipping Tool.
Using your inspiration photo to create a Google Image Search
Now that you have a screenshot ready, you can use it to start a search. If you go to Google and look at the right side of the search box, you’ll see a little camera icon. When you hover on the camera icon you should see a tool tip that says Search by image.

Click on the tool tip. Now, you can drag and drop your inspiration photo into the search box.

You should get results for similar styles of furniture and decor at a range of quality levels and price points, making it easy to follow your budget.
